Paintless Dent Repair vs. Body Shop: Choosing the Right Technique

When your car suffers a impact, deciding between PDR and a traditional body shop can be tricky. PDR is a technique that uses specialized tools to gently massage the dent from behind, often without needing paint. This makes it a quicker and budget-friendly option for minor damage. On the other hand, body shops are better equipped to handle extensive damage that requires repairing. They also have the expertise to match paint colors and ensure a seamless finish. Ultimately, the best choice depends on the severity of the damage and your budget.
